Introduction: Bridging the Environment Gap in Software Development

For software professionals across Chennai, a frustratingly familiar scenario unfolds regularly: an application works perfectly on a developer’s local machine but mysteriously fails in testing, staging, or production environments. This “environment inconsistency” problem causes costly delays, consumes countless debugging hours, and creates friction between development and operations teams. In Chennai’s growing technology ecosystem, where companies range from established enterprise IT departments to ambitious startups, this challenge undermines productivity and slows digital transformation efforts.

What You Will Learn from This Course

Comprehensive Docker Tool Proficiency: You’ll gain practical experience with Docker’s complete ecosystem, including Docker Engine for container runtime, Docker CLI for management, Docker Compose for defining multi-service applications, Docker Swarm for clustering, and Docker Registry for image storage. The focus remains on real-world usage patterns rather than just command syntax.

Effective Image Creation and Management: The course provides thorough coverage of Dockerfile development, teaching you to create efficient, secure, and maintainable container images. You’ll learn techniques like multi-stage builds to minimize image sizes, layer optimization to accelerate builds, and security scanning to identify vulnerabilities before deployment. These skills ensure the containers you create are production-ready.

Container Networking and Storage Understanding: You’ll develop a solid grasp of Docker’s networking models and storage options—critical knowledge for deploying applications beyond simple single-container scenarios. The training covers bridge networks, host networks, overlay networks for multi-host communication, and various approaches to managing persistent data in inherently ephemeral container environments.

Integration with Development Workflows: Beyond isolated Docker usage, you’ll learn how to incorporate containers into complete software development lifecycles. This includes using Docker for local development environments, integrating containers with continuous integration and delivery pipelines, and implementing container strategies that align with DevOps methodologies increasingly adopted by Chennai’s forward-thinking organizations.

Practical Troubleshooting and Optimization Skills: Through scenario-based exercises, you’ll develop problem-solving abilities for common container challenges. You’ll learn debugging techniques for containerized applications, performance optimization approaches, logging and monitoring implementation, and security hardening practices specific to container deployments.

How This Course Helps in Real Projects and Work Environments

The practical focus of this training ensures immediate workplace applicability for Chennai’s technology professionals. Consider these common scenarios where Docker expertise delivers tangible value:

Modernizing Traditional Applications: Chennai hosts numerous organizations with critical legacy applications running on conventional architectures. This training provides skills to containerize these applications progressively—packaging components into containers without complete rewrites. You’ll learn approaches for handling stateful applications, managing data persistence across container lifecycles, and implementing gradual modernization paths that deliver measurable benefits at each stage while minimizing business risk.

Standardizing Development Environments: Development teams frequently lose productive time configuring local environments with correct dependencies and settings. This course teaches you to create Docker-based development environments that are identical across all team members’ systems. New developers can become productive within hours instead of days, and the entire team avoids “environment-specific” bugs that surface unpredictably. This standardization is particularly valuable in Chennai’s growing remote and hybrid work environments.

Implementing Scalable Microservices: As companies decompose monolithic applications into more manageable microservices, Docker provides the ideal packaging mechanism for individual services. You’ll learn how to containerize microservices, implement service discovery, manage inter-service communication, and establish development workflows that support independent service development and deployment—skills essential for Chennai organizations adopting cloud-native architectures.

Optimizing CI/CD Pipelines: Containerization significantly simplifies continuous integration and delivery processes. This training teaches you to create Docker images as consistent, versioned artifacts that flow reliably through testing, staging, and production environments. You’ll implement “build once, deploy anywhere” pipelines that reduce deployment failures and accelerate release cycles—capabilities that provide competitive advantages in Chennai’s dynamic business landscape.
